How is article 7 of the Energy Efficiency Directive being implemented? An analysis of national energy efficiency obligation schemes
<p>The Energy Efficiency Directive (EED) is the main policy instrument at the EU level to reach the 20% energy saving goal in 2020. Article 7 is a key pillar of the EED, which requires Member States (MS) to introduce energy efficiency obligation schemes (EEOSs). Under the EEOS, energy companie...
